Which teams will play in Super Bowl LVIII?
The best time of the year has arrived for lovers of tackling, as the NFL began on September 7, 32 franchises with the dream of winning the Super Bowl. However, it is clear that some are much more likely to crystallize that goal, and Artificial Intelligence gives us a possible “spoiler”.
For this exercise, FOX Sports consulted two different AI platforms: Google’s Bard and You.com. Interestingly, both came up with the exact prediction for the 2024 Super Bowl to be held in Las Vegas inside Allegiant Stadium for the first time in history.
Although the Cincinnati Bengals, San Francisco 49ers, Buffalo Bills, and Dallas Cowboys are among the serious candidates, both Bard and You established that the Kansas City Chiefs and Philadelphia Eagles would re-edit the Super Bowl, which in February 2023 was decided with a win for the former.
Who will win the 2024 Super Bowl?
The AI analysis highlights Kansas City’s head coach Andy Reid’s knowledge and notes that the team has one of the most formidable attacks in the league thanks to stars like Travis Kelce and Patrick Mahomes, who have won two rings with the team in the last four years.
Given that Philadelphia’s quarterback, Jalen Hurts, is among the league’s most mobile players, the AI suggests that the team’s main weapon will be the ground attack. Incorporate newcomers Rashad Penny, D’Andre Swift, and Kenneth Gainwell into the running back corps.
He also highlights the depth of the team, especially on defense, where there are experienced veterans like Haason Reddick, Brandon Graham, and Fletcher Cox in addition to incredibly gifted young players like Nakobe Dean, Jalen Carter, Jordan Davis, and Nolan Smith.
In conclusion, Bard and You predict that the Kansas City Chiefs will win Super Bowl LVIII and repeat as NFL champions, marking their fourth Vince Lombardi trophy in history and third in the last five seasons, thus solidifying their status as the new dynasty.

Who will sing in Super Bowl 2024?
The 2024 Super Bowl Halftime Show will include a performance by Usher. Following other rumors about other musicians, the NFL and Apple Music verified the information by posting content on social media (including an advertisement featuring Kim Kardashian). One of the most notable male representations of R&B, dance, and pop is the American vocalist.

Where is the Super Bowl 2024?
In keeping with the tradition that has been established for decades, the LVIII Super Bowl will take place in Paradise, Nevada, inside Allegiant Stadium, home of the Las Vegas Raiders. Host cities typically make an impression.
Favorite menu during the Super Bowl
Even though there should be a wide variety of food options at a party like the Super Bowl, fans’ only option on this particular day would be chicken wings. They are so well-liked that billions of them are consumed annually during the celebration. According to the annual wings report from the National Chicken Council, 1.42 billion wings were consumed in the United States last year.
Furthermore, Americans eat 14 billion hamburgers and drink an estimated 200 million liters of beer on that Sunday, along with consuming an estimated 3.6 million kilograms of guacamole to go with over 14,500 tons of French fries.
